Improved salt tolerance and delayed leaf senescence in transgenic cotton expressing the Agrobacterium IPT gene

open access: yes, 2012
The manipulation of cytokinin contents via Agrobacterium-mediated transformation is an efficient tool for delaying leaf senescence and improving the resistance to environmental stresses.

The impact of photosynthesis on initiation of leaf senescence [PDF]

open access: yesPhysiologia Plantarum, 2019
Senescence is the last stage of leaf development preceding the death of the organ, and it is important for nutrient remobilization and for feeding sink tissues. There are many reports on leaf senescence, but the mechanisms initiating leaf senescence are still poorly understood. Leaf senescence is affected by many environmental factors and seems to vary
